If you review my pregame thoughts on this game I figured USF would look very young in this game and they did. Having 13 new starters, along with a new soph QB who hasn't taken a snap, I had this game at 31-17 Bods before I walked into the stadium. The Washburn QB and OL/DL was the difference I saw in this game, more than anything else. USF is most challenged at those positions, while Washburn is very good at those spots..and USF was forced into the QB trying to pass (and scramble when nothing was open), as USF couldn't match up this year with the size and athleticism of Washburn. The Bods OL did a very good job of walling off USF upfront, and Dane picked USF apart early, with USF only showing real signs of heat in the 2nd half..and by that time it was certainly too late, damage was done.

As a USF fan I was pleased to see how they battled and showed heart, getting the game back to 27-14 in the 3rd..but the Bods are just a better football team and sit up a fantastic play action pass for a dagger-score.

USF will have to continue cutting it's teeth on this very difficult opening schedule next week at NWMSU, and I'm hoping to see the young guys continue to develop and get better. All said, USF brings back almost everyone for next year when they start up the NSIC schedule..and realistically if this team can gain a full year or experience they will be far better prepared come Sept 1 of 2012.
